Latest Patents
One of Dean Corrion’s notable innovations is the “Vehicle Cup Holder Arm Assembly.” This invention comprises a vehicle component featuring a cup holder opening and an adjacent aperture. The assembly includes a base that is injection molded from a first material, designed with an attachment feature that extends into the aperture and can be moved between extended and collapsed positions. An arm cup, made from a second material, is partially molded around the base and features a rotatable arm, allowing for the adjustable securing of a cup in the cup holder. This design facilitates vertical movement, accommodating differently-sized cups, and ensures ease of use. Additionally, Corrion developed a method of manufacturing this assembly, allowing for effective production of the vehicle cup holder arm and emphasizing the importance of user-friendly automotive designs.
